Overlooking Dieppe Gardens and the Detroit River, the Hilton Windsor is within walking distance of Casino Windsor and four miles from Windsor Airport. It's also adjacent to the Cleary Convention Center. The Greek Town Casino and MGM Casino in Detroit are less than 10 minutes away. The River Runner Bar and the Park Terrace restaurant offer great dining choices, whether guests desire a snack by the big-screen TV or full-service dining with views of the Detroit River and skyline. Recreational amenities include a fully equipped fitness center and indoor heated swimming pool. All rooms have unobstructed views of the Detroit skyline, as well as dual-line telephones with voice mail and dataports.
